Преобразование даты в Java [дубликат]

Login Helper вашего сайта

$ loginUrl = $ helper-> getLoginUrl ('xyz.com/user_by_facebook/', $ permissions);

и в панели инструментов приложения facebook ( На вкладке продуктов: Facebook Login)

Действительные URI перенаправления OAuth также должны быть одинаковыми для xyz.com/user_by_facebook/

, как упоминалось ранее, при обращении к веб-сайту

-5
задан azro 13 July 2018 в 12:09
поделиться

1 ответ

Для этого я использовал бы DateTimeFormatter. Вы можете найти дополнительную информацию в документах. https://docs.oracle.com/javase/8/docs/api/java/time/format/DateTimeFormatter.html

Однако здесь приведен пример:

DateTimeFormatter parser = DateTimeFormatter.ofPattern("EEE MMM dd HH:mm:ss zzz yyyy", Locale.US);
LocalDateTime date = LocalDateTime.parse("Sun Apr 01 01:00:00 EEST 2018", parser);
DateTimeFormatter formatter = DateTimeFormatter.ofPattern("dd-MM-yyyy HH:mm:ss");
System.out.println(formatter.format(date)); //01-04-2018 01:00:00

Часть Locale.US требуется, даже если вы не живете в США, иначе она не сможет разбирать ВС в воскресенье и с апреля по апрель и так далее. Вероятно, он работает с Locale.UK и более, но, к примеру, он не работает для меня, потому что я живу в Швейцарии.

2
ответ дан Alexander 17 August 2018 в 12:57
поделиться
Другие вопросы по тегам:

Похожие вопросы: